Output ddd2b8d819b6931eae23edfa4c2b02699b08cb8740cc86ec5212f3a514b92267:16

value
136668
script pubkey
OP_0 OP_PUSHBYTES_32 3c013babdd149b9d675949c021223f58903ca1ff3b30ca8980426b60371e6c04
address
bc1q8sqnh27azjde6e6ef8qzzg3ltzgreg0l8vcv4zvqgf4kqdc7dszqr9tcgc
transaction
ddd2b8d819b6931eae23edfa4c2b02699b08cb8740cc86ec5212f3a514b92267
confirmations
187760
spent
true